Q23.0 is the ICD-10 code for Congenital stenosis of aortic valve. It is a four-character subcategory of Q23 (Congenital malformations of aortic and mitral valves), the most specific level in the WHO edition. It belongs to the block Q20–Q28 (Congenital malformations of the circulatory system) in Chapter XVII, Congenital malformations, deformations and chromosomal abnormalities.

What Q23.0 includes
Conditions and terms that are coded here.
- Congenital aortic:
- atresia
- stenosis
